Company That Provides Endorsed Auto/Homeowners Program Being Sold

Zurich Financial Services Group subsidiary, Farmers Group, Inc, announced in April that it has agreed to acquire 21st Century Insurance (a rebranded company, currently an AIG subsidiary). With the incorporation of the 21st Century Insurance business, Farmers Group, Inc. will be positioned as the 3rd largest personal lines insurer in the United States.  In the words of Zurich’s Chief Executive Officer, James J. Schiro, “Now, in addition to a powerful and productive agency force, the Farmers family will also have one of the most successful direct distribution platforms within one of the fastest growing distribution channels in the U.S.” 

The following are facts about Farmers Group, Inc.:

  • Founded in 1928.
  • Headquartered in Los Angeles, CA.
  • Reportedly one the most recognized and fastest growing insurance brands.
  • 3rd largest personal lines insurer in the United States with over $15 billion in premium.
  • Subsidiary of Zurich Financial Services Group with a worldwide network of subsidiaries in 150 countries. 

The completion of the sale to Farmers Group, Inc. is expected to close by no later than the third quarter of 2009, pending regulatory approvals.
